通过ODBC创建ACCESS 2000 的数据库文件:
uses DAO97;
function CreateAccessDB(FileName:String;bOffice97:boolean=true):boolean;
var
CreateAccess:OleVariant;
CreateMSG:string;
begin
Result:=false;
if not FileExists(FileName) then
begin
CreateAccess:=CreateOleObject('ADOX.Catalog');
if not bOffice97 then
CreateMSG:='Provider=Microsoft.Jet.OLEDB.4.0;'
else
CreateMSG:='Provider=Microsoft.Jet.OLEDB.3.51;';
CreateMSG:=CreateMSG+'Data Source='+FileName;
try
CreateAccess.Create(CreateMSG);
Result:=true;
except
Result:=false;
end;
end;
end;
创建ACCESS 2000数据库
最新推荐文章于 2024-09-04 11:52:12 发布
本文介绍了一种使用ODBC接口结合ADOX组件来创建Access 2000数据库的方法。该方法通过设置不同的Provider参数来区分Office 97版和非97版的Access数据库,并提供了详细的Delphi代码实现。
788

被折叠的 条评论
为什么被折叠?



